Human Resources Management at UNH
Build stronger workplaces through human resources expertise. Today’s HR professionals do more than manage policies, they shape workplace culture, drive organizational performance, and support employees at every level. Our Human Resources Management program is designed to help you develop the practical skills and strategic insight needed to navigate the complexities of the modern workforce.
Explore topics such as employee relations, performance management, compliance, workplace diversity, and leadership development. Whether you're new to HR or looking to stay current in a rapidly evolving field, this program offers flexible learning options, available in Portsmouth, Manchester, and live online via Zoom, to fit your goals and schedule.
SHRM Certification Test Prep
This comprehensive program, led by a SHRM-Certified HR practitioner, prepares you to earn your SHRM-CP or SHRM-SCP with a detailed review of the current SHRM Body of Applied Skills & Knowledge® (SHRM BASK®).
HR Leadership
In today’s workplace, where HR professionals are expected to lead, collaborate, and advise, this interactive workshop explores the definition of HR leadership and focuses on three essential competencies: personal credibility, broad business knowledge, and specialized HR expertise.
Human Resources 101
As managers and employees increasingly expect HR professionals to lead, partner, and collaborate, this workshop explores the meaning of HR leadership and highlights three essential competencies: personal credibility, broad business knowledge, and specialized HR expertise.
Managing Workplace Accommodation, Leave, and Workers' Comp Challenges
Designed for HR professionals, managers, and compliance leaders, this workshop provides a clear guide to three key areas of workplace management—ADA, PWFA, and religious accommodations—while clarifying leave policies and workers’ compensation across federal, state, and organizational levels.
Compensation 101
Learn how to design a competitive, flexible rewards and recognition program—including salary, bonuses, benefits, perks, and recognition—to attract and retain talent while meeting the diverse needs of today’s workforce.
Unlocking Potential
This interactive session equips HR professionals, managers, and team leaders with essential tools and knowledge to build and sustain successful talent development strategies, focusing on programming, training, and feedback loops.
